The Artwork: Somerset Skate Park

  • Title: Somerset Skate Park
  • Creator: Exld
  • Creator Nationality: Filipino
  • Creator Gender: Male
  • Date: 2010
  • Project: Filipino Street Art Project
  • Location: Somerset Skatepark, Singapore
  • Type: Street Art
  • Medium: Spray Paint
